VTPB 425
Biomedical Microbiology
Texas A&M University · UGRD · Fall 2026
Catalog description
Credits 3. 3 Lecture Hours. This course is designed to provide learners with an opportunity to gain an understanding of the fundamentals of microbiology, including bacteriology, mycology, protozoology and virology, with specific emphasis on infectious diseases of humans and animals. This course will be offered in a welcoming and intellectually stimulating setting to promote active participation of learners. All students are encouraged to engage in classroom discussions for easier assimilation and a comprehensive understanding of the subject matter. Prerequisites: Grade of C or better in BIOL 112 , CHEM 258 , and PHYS 202 ; grade of C or better in MATH 142 , MATH 147 , MATH 151 , or MATH 171 ; junior classification in Biomedical Sciences; may have concurrent enrollment with VTPB 426 .
